Servlet
它是一个符合规定规范的Java程序,是一个基于Java技术的Web组件,运行在服务器端,由Servlet容器所管理,用于生成动态的内容。
主要应用于HTTP协议的请求和相应。
Servlet容器:
Servlet容器也叫Servlet引擎,是Web服务器或应用程序服务器的一部分,用于在发送的请求和响应之上提供网络服务。
Servlet就是运行在服务器端的Java程序。
Servlet与JSP都可以在页面上动态显示数据。
开发Servlet需要用到的主要接口和类,也就是Servlet API。
使用Servlet API可以开发HTTP Servlet或其他Servlet,Servlet API包含在两个包内。
java.servlet.http包中的类和接口是用于支持HTTP协议的Servlet API。
Servlet的生命周期:
Servlet的生命周期是通过Servlet接口中的init()、service()和destory()方法来表示的。